Для управления выходным напряжением на ESP32 в диапазоне 0-15V с наименьшим возможным шагом изменения, можно использовать внешний ЦАП (Цифро-Аналоговый Преобразователь). ESP32 не имеет встроенного ЦАП с такими характеристиками, поэтому вам потребуется использовать внешнее устройство. Примером может быть ЦАП на базе MCP4725, который позволяет установить выходное напряжение с разрешением до 12 бит, что обеспечит вам максимально возможное количество значений в диапазоне от 0 до 15V.
Чтобы создать имитатор для датчиков с выходным напряжением от 0 до 3.3В с использованием ESP32, можно также воспользоваться внешним ЦАПом. В данном случае можно использовать ЦАП на базе MCP4725 или подобный, который поддерживает выходное напряжение в диапазоне от 0 до 3.3В. Программируя ESP32, вы сможете устанавливать нужные значения напряжения на ЦАПе, чтобы имитировать работу датчиков.
Таким образом, использование внешних ЦАПов позволит вам управлять выходным напряжением на ESP32 с нужной точностью и создать имитаторы для датчиков с необходимым диапазоном напряжения.